About the LLCOA
(Lime Lake Cottage Owners Association, Inc.)
(An excerpt from the 29th Annual Lime Lake Directory 1968)

The Lime Lake Cottage Owners Association, Inc. became incorporated in Sept. 1959, although its origin was some fifteen years prior.

Its purpose is to mutually benefit the members of the association, for protection of their properties, to improve the water facilities of Lime Lake and to provide social and athletic activities for its members.  The government of the association is vested in the ten members of the Board Of Directors, serving three year terms upon election at the annual meeting.

In the past the LLCOA has endeavored to control the weeds of the lake by use of weed killer, which has been very successful over a short period, however, surveys made by the Cattaraugus County Department of Health have indicated the present method of weed cutting to be the best practical method to control the aging of the lake.  The LLCOA now owns three weed cutters with boats and motors which are available to its members for cutting weeds at their lakefront properties.

The present Board of Directors have a full program for the coming summer, commencing with a street dance on their tennis courts, the annual meeting in June,, the annual July 4th Chicken Barbeque, the annual boat parade, the annual pizza sale, the second ski show by the Lime Lake Ski Club and the closing Labor Day weekend street dance, with the Circle of Flares and moonlight boat ride on Sunday, Labor Day eve.

The continuing build-up of activities have united the Lake community into a closer group.  Within the past year the LLCOA has started a program of stump removal in the Lake and has cooperated with the County Health Board to improve the conditions existing in the Lake.  Although the association membership is confined to 60 percent of the cottage owners, this will surely encompass a greater percentage of the cottage owners when they become aware of the benefits they reap through the nominal annual dues.
